Left-sided radiotherapy linked to cardiovascular stenosis
Thursday 2 February 2012
A Swedish study shows that breast cancer patients receiving radiotherapy to the left side of the chest presented increased coronary artery stenosis in the left anterior descending artery. This research clarifies the importance of taking into account which side of the body is receiving radiation when estimating cardiovascular risk to the patient.
